In this communication an efficient method of moments (MoM) code is used for the analysis of the extraordinary transmission (EOT) through a periodic array of rectangular slots in a conducting screen, in the case where the number of slots is finite in one direction and infinite in the orthogonal direction. The slots can be arbitrarily rotated within the periodic unit cell. Once the magnetic current density on the slots is obtained by means of MoM, both the transmission coefficient and the far-field radiated by the array of slots are computed. The onset of EOT turns out to be strongly dependent on the orientation of the slots with respect to the direction in which the array is infinite. If the slots are perpendicular to this direction, EOT appears for a single infinite chain of slots. However, tens of parallel chains of slots are required to reproduce the EOT response when the slots are aligned along the parallel chains direction. The obtained radiation patterns show the excitation of grating lobes as the number of slots grow in the direction where the arrays are finite. |
